When two-year-old Benjamin is lured away from his mother at a shopping centre and brutally murdered, the last people anyone would suspect are two little boys …

Ten years later the perpetrators are released under new identities, living within the community they tore apart. With a hostile media determined to expose them and a grieving father vowing to avenge his child, just how long can their secret remain hidden?

Focusing on the aftermath of a shocking crime, Jane Jago challenges our ideas of childhood innocence and addresses the human need to comprehend what drives the worst in us all.
